#eb9999 color RGB value is (235,153,153). #eb9999 color name is Custom Color color.
#eb9999 hex color red value is 235, green value is 153 and the blue value of its RGB is 153.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#eb9999 hue: 0.00, saturation: 0.67 and the lightness value of eb9999 is 0.76.
The process color (four color CMYK) of #eb9999 color hex is 0.00, 0.35, 0.35, 0.08. Web safe color of #eb9999 is #ff9999. Color #eb9999 contains mainly RED color.

About #EB9999 Custom Color
#EB9999 (Custom Color) is a red-based color with RGB values of 235, 153, 153. This color belongs to the red color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.
When working with #eb9999,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.
For web development, #eb9999 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#eb9999), RGB (rgb(235, 153, 153)), HSL (hsl(0, 67%, 76%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#ff9999,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
